Trenggulun tree, Tengulun tree
Protium javanicum

Family: Burseraceae


What it is like

A shrub or tree. It can grow 9-25 m tall. The trunk is often short and crooked. This can be 40-115 cm across. The branches can have spines 7 cm long. The leaves are opposite and narrowly oval. There can be teeth along the edge. The flowers are in groups. The fruit is a berry and purplish-green but turns red to black when ripe.


Where it is found

A tropical plant. It grows in dense primary forest. It grows up to 800 m above sea level. It is more common in regions with a distinct dry season

How it is grown

Plants can be grown from seeds.

It can flower and fruit throughout the season.
